AI That Knows When to Stay Quiet

For years, phone makers have promised “AI at your fingertips.” The Pixel 10 takes a different approach: it whispers instead of shouting. Magic Cue, Google’s new context-aware assistant, quietly steps in before you even ask. Writing a message? It surfaces the address you copied earlier. On a call? Your flight details appear just in time. It’s the kind of help that feels invisible until you realize your phone is saving you seconds—and sometimes stress.

Private Conversations in Any Language

The most talked-about upgrade, though, is Voice Translate. During a call, you can speak in English and be heard in Spanish—or Mandarin, or French—without breaking the flow. The twist: the translation comes back in your own voice. And because the processing happens on the device, not in the cloud, those conversations never leave your phone. In an age of data leaks and hacks, that makes the Pixel 10 feel less like a gadget and more like a trusted companion.

A Camera That Pushes Boundaries

Photography has always been Pixel’s calling card, and the 10th generation doesn’t hold back. The Pro models boast Pro Res Zoom, allowing users to stretch clarity to a staggering 100×. Early testers say the results are startlingly clean—photos that would’ve been a noisy blur now look crisp enough to frame. Add to that a Camera Coach that gives live feedback on framing and composition, and even casual users can shoot like they’ve had lessons. Still, the innovation sparks debate: if AI is rewriting your photo, is it still a photograph—or something new altogether?
